The Rhodesian Ridgeback: A Brief Overview

The Rhodesian Ridgeback is a large and muscular hound that originated in Southern Africa. Known for its distinctive ridge of hair along its back, the breed was originally bred to track and hunt lions. Despite its hunting background, the Rhodesian Ridgeback is a gentle and loving companion with its family. The breed is loyal, protective, and highly intelligent, making it an excellent choice for families looking for a devoted pet.

The Akbash: A Brief Overview

The Akbash is a Turkish livestock guardian breed that has been used for centuries to protect flocks of sheep from predators. Known for its large size, strength, and calm demeanor, the Akbash is a formidable guardian that is fiercely protective of its charges. Despite its working background, the Akbash is a gentle and affectionate breed with its family. The breed is independent, intelligent, and loyal, making it an excellent choice for experienced dog owners.

Caring for and Training the Rhodesian Ridgeback-Akbash Cross

Like all dogs, the Rhodesian Ridgeback-Akbash cross requires proper care and training to thrive. Due to its large size and protective instincts, this mix needs plenty of exercise and mental stimulation to keep it happy and healthy. Daily walks, playtime, and training sessions are essential to prevent boredom and destructive behaviors. Additionally, the hybrid will benefit from early socialization to ensure that it is well-behaved around people and other animals.

When it comes to training, the Rhodesian Ridgeback-Akbash cross is likely to be intelligent and eager to please. Positive reinforcement techniques, such as praise and treats, are effective in teaching obedience and desirable behaviors. Consistent training and leadership are also important to establish boundaries and prevent the hybrid from becoming dominant or aggressive.

In terms of grooming, the Rhodesian Ridgeback-Akbash cross is likely to have a short and dense coat that requires minimal maintenance. Regular brushing and occasional baths are all that is needed to keep the hybrid looking clean and healthy. Additionally, regular dental care, nail trimming, and ear cleaning are important to prevent health issues and keep the dog comfortable.
